James E. McCoy Obituary

We are sad to announce that on April 22, 2022 we had to say goodbye to James E. McCoy of Quaker City, Ohio, born in Sylacauga, Alabama. He was predeceased by: his parents, William McCoy and Audrey McCoy (Gardner); his sisters, Shirley Price and Alice Culberson; and his children, James, Donald Devereux and Roberta Miller.

He is survived by: his wife Mary C. McCoy (Blondheim); his children, Kenneth Devereux (Thericia), P. J. Devereux, Mary Devereux and Ramona Schoolcraft (Robert); and his siblings, Floyd (Edie McCoy), Harold McCoy, Harvey McCoy, Margaret McCoy Samples and Faye Duke Wilson. He is also survived by twenty grandchildren; twenty-eight great-grandchildren; and many nieces & nephews.
